As a Production Scheduler, you will have the skills to prioritise and plan activities considering all relevant issues and factors. You will be able to think ahead in order to establish an efficient and appropriate course of action.
Key Responsibilities:
1. Liaise with Operations regarding scheduling conflicts or issues.
2. Demonstrate continuous effort to improve operations, decrease turnaround times, streamline work processes, and work cooperatively and jointly to provide quality.
3. Coordinate with Client Services on inbound work.
4. Ensure staffing levels are sufficient for the workload.
5. Maximise efficiency by scheduling production to ensure expectations are achieved.
6. Constantly plan out all warehouse resources and activities in relation to the daily, weekly, and monthly schedules.
7. Coordinate the demand forecast of all customers and share the forecast with all internal and external suppliers.
8. Resource planning in collaboration with suppliers, including current stock inventory and forecast demand.
9. Respond in real time to disruptions.
